Lewisham Council is seeking dedicated support workers to join the Enablement team, assisting individuals returning home from hospital to regain independence in daily tasks. This community-based role involves working in clients' homes with a focus on care and support.
Qualified candidates will have:
- Excellent communication skills
- Caregiving experience
- The ability to encourage clients
Work hours include various shift patterns that may involve weekends. A generous salary package and employee benefits are offered.
